Output f4ba68c10a2634d22b791249593f0c78d634d4b84d897e23e59bfd82cfccafb0:1

value
299062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 686e25e664195ca9185a6efd9c59aeb55c89f5b8 OP_EQUAL
address
3BDC9iQ5mZbdXY3payiKfMgoz9juQdxcYB
transaction
f4ba68c10a2634d22b791249593f0c78d634d4b84d897e23e59bfd82cfccafb0
spent
true